    Pokémon StunningSteel is hack of Pokémon Fire Red made by Vcaveman of the PokéCommunity, and is currently in beta and goes up to the sixth gym, Fuchsia City's. It follows the storyline of Fire Red, but there are several big changes that set it apart as an improved Fire Red hack. For example, your story begins with you being seventeen years old and finally able to get a Pokémon. However, your background is quite different besides the age change. You start your journey in the year 2008, just ten years after the Great Pokémon War Kanto had. A war in which your father, now deceased, fought in with his Steel Type Pokémon. He became a national hero, and yet you know very little about him, while it seems so many people know so much more. Like your father, you are a strong trainer who has competed across many battle facilities with rental Pokémon since you couldn't raise your own yet.

    With your character's background out of the way, let's look at the start of their journey. Upon going to Oak's lab, you get the choice of three very interesting starter Pokémon. Each are designed to change the difficulty in some way. They are Cyndaquil, Aerodactyl, and Kakuna. A very unexpected group for a ROM hack! Upon seeing these three, I found it to be a pretty fun set. Each one changing the difficulty is a unique element to include in a game! I had to of course choose Aerodactyl, although Cyndaquil was a close runner up (sorry, Kakuna, you're still cool though). Making my way through battles was a lot of fun with it. The fact that the ROM hack also includes most Pokémon from generations one to three, as well as many gen 6 mechanics, such as indoor running and poison not affecting you outside of battle, was great. Being able to still play the game like it's Fire Red (added Pokémon have low encounter rates to make it still feel like Kanto), while getting to use newer Pokémon is always great. It's nice to see this increase for ROM hacks over time! It also can change the difficulty depending on your team. The difficulty can still be a challenge at times. In the infamous Genesis Cave fight in the demo, many people had trouble with it. Although, I found it to be hard, but not impossible, it's worth noting. If you like challenge, then you may enjoy that battle quite a bit! if you don't, don't let it steer you away! There's a helpful guide and plenty of options for beating it! In addition to this difficulty, the story gets some new elements that come into play early on.

    StunningSteel introduces several new characters. There are new rivals in addition to Gary, such as Vanessa, a young girl who you meet early on and see all throughout the story. There is also a mysterious man who keeps appearing to you and challenges your skill with his high levelled Houndoom. Who is he? You'll learn more about him on your journey, so the only way to find out, is to play the beta! Moving on, an important feature to note as well, is that PokéBalls are more expensive, but are reusable if you don't catch what you threw the ball at. So spend wisely! These aren't all the changes though! There are many new and fun events for you to discover! There are even many dialog changes that will add more insight to the story of your character and the world around you! The events that happen in Fire Red aren't the only ones that are a part of the story. With the new characters, there are new locations and storylines not present in the original! All of which add to the uniqueness this hack has. One big change that occurs because of this, is a system where your choices matter! Depending on what you say or do, your story will change, relationships with characters may stay the same, or become very different.
